Placeholder is a venture capital firm. Partners Joel Monegro and Chris Burniske manage the firm with Brad Burnham as venture partner. Mario Laul is our Head of Research and Shelly Gogol is our General Manager. Since 2017, we have invested in over 75 early-stage companies and networks, including:

Aleo Avantgarde Arx Backpack Botanix Celestia Eclipse Ethereum Gearbox Gyroscope Jito Kamino Magic Monad Movement Obol Orca Pocket Polymer Saga Solana Solend Squads Tensor Tally WeatherXM Zerion zkSync and more.

Leveling the Stakes on Solana

The process of updating Solana has waterfall effects on Solana’s incentive design, validator economics, and therefore, validator set equity. Certain proposals, such as Alpenglow, are inevitable upgrades given their performance, engineering, and user experience benefits. Under the assumption of these proposals and their economic side effects, we found that a modified version of SIMD-228 and a lower VAT fee of 0.135 SOL/day would be optimal for validator decentralization, pending a more formal discussion of Alpenglow’s reward schemes.

Revisiting L1 Tokens as Money: A Critique of ‘Monetary Premium’

One of the oldest debates in crypto focuses on the relationship between the adoption of L1 blockchain networks and the value accrual of their native tokens. The debate is unresolved but it is generally believed that, as long as the L1 token is the preferred asset for transacting on the network, the most widely adopted networks will also end up hosting the most valuable tokens. While the details of the exact argument are network- and token-specific, there is one additional idea that has been echoing in these discussions for at least 10 years. For many, it is the most important distinguishing factor between a handful of L1 ’blue chips’ and the ever-growing long tail of the crypto asset universe at large. That idea is known as ’monetary premium’ and it is rooted in a fundamental misunderstanding of money.

Combined Metrics for Tracking Smart Contract Networks

One of the key advantages of blockchain networks over other digital platforms is that data about assets and transactions hosted on a blockchain is publicly available. This allows for close to real-time tracking of how different networks compare across a variety of metrics. The most reliable method for assessing the usage of a particular blockchain is to zoom in on individual measures, ideally at the level of specific applications or user groups. However, that’s not always feasible. As the number of networks and the amount of data grows, various forms of aggregation are required to simplify the tracking process without losing the ability to identify when and where a closer look at the underlying data is warranted. This post provides an overview of one such attempt at metrics aggregation.
